Marc Evans's Patagonia, shot in Welsh and Spanish languages, is this year's UK Oscar entry in the foreign-language film category for the 84th Academy Awards®. Previous Oscar-nominations were for Wales, Hedd Wynn in 1993 and Solomon and Gaenor in 1999.
